Virus infection detection and identification method based on metagenomics

The invention provides a virus infection detection and identification technology based on metagenomics. The virus infection detection and identification technology based on the metagenomics comprises the four portions of sample preparation, high-throughput sequencing, bioinformatic analysis and result re-checking. In the sample preparation portion, viral nucleic acid is effectively extracted or enriched from detection samples according to the requirements of the virus infection detection and identification technology based on the metagenomics and characteristics of different types of detection samples, and a nucleic acid library which can be used for a next-generation sequencing instrument is established. In the high-throughput sequencing portion, the nucleic acid library established in the sample preparation step is sequenced so to obtain sufficient high-quality nucleic acid sequence information. In the bioinformatic analysis portion, a large number of high-quality nucleic acid sequences obtained in the high-throughput sequencing step is analyzed to further obtain viral component information prompted by the nucleic acid of the samples. In the result re-checking portion, a bioinformatic analysis result and other information, such as technical contrast, are integrated to perform comprehensive study and judgment, finally alternative infection virus is determined, and other technologies, such as PCR, are utilized to perform re-checking.

Full-automatic genital tract infection detection system

The invention discloses a full-automatic genital tract infection detection system which comprises a plurality of joint inspection cards for detecting a sample, an automatic supply unit, an automatic card dispatching unit, an automatic sample injection unit, an automatic transmission unit, an automatic incubation unit, a reagent injection unit, an automatic measuring and reading unit and an electrical control unit, wherein the electrical control unit controls automatic running of all the units through software of a computer. According to the full-automatic genital tract infection detection system disclosed by the invention, due to the processes of automatic card dispatching, automatic sample injection, automatic incubation, automatic measuring and reading and the like which are controlled through the computer, manual participation steps are reduced, the measuring and reading accuracy is improved, and the test speed of detecting more than a set number of samples per hour can be achieved.

Early infection detection kit of monoclonal antibody-mediated pig pleuropneumoniae

The invention relates to the research field of biological diagnostic reagents, in particular to an ELISA (Enzyme-Linked Immunosorbent Assay) kit for detecting APP (Actinobacillus Pleuropneumoniae). The kit comprises a washing solution, a colorimetric solution, a stopping solution, a positive control specimen, a negative control specimen and an ELISA plate coating a first antibody as well as a second antibody for detection, wherein the first antibody is a monoclonal protein antibody of the APP rApxIVN, and the second antibody is a biotin-labeled monoclonal protein antibody of the APP rApxIVN. The invention can be applied to detecting APP-infected pig serum and has favorable importance and sensitivity.

Primer probe group for detecting mycobacterium tuberculosis complex and rpoB mutation based on multi-enzyme isothermal rapid amplification technology and application of primer probe group

The invention relates to the technical field of molecular biology and clinical detection, in particular to a primer probe group for detecting a mycobacterium tuberculosis complex and rpoB mutations based on a multi-enzyme isothermal rapid amplification technology and application of the primer probe group. A 1296th-site base mutation of an rpoB gene is used as a molecular marker for identifying a mycobacterium tuberculosis complex strain, and a specific primer probe group is designed aiming at amino acid mutations of the 1296th-site and a 516th site, a 526th site and a 531st site of the rpoB; amethod for detecting the mycobacterium tuberculosis complex strain and the rpoB mutations based on a multi-enzyme isothermal rapid amplification technology is developed. The primer probe group disclosed by the invention is high in detection sensitivity and strong in specificity; the method has the advantages of low dependence on equipment, short detection time, realization of rapid and accurate detection, realization of visual detection in combination with a lateral flow test strip, and important application values for the infection detection of the Mycobacterium tuberculosis complex strain and the drug resistance detection of Mycobacterium tuberculosis.

Sensor Management And Record Tracking System

The present invention is an early infection detection system comprising: a housing having a sensor system section and tray section; an inflow port in fluid communications with a catheter to allow bodily fluid to flow from a patient into the tray section; a color sensor included in the sensor section and in electrical communications with a control module configured to sense the color of a reagent and convert the color to a numeric value representing the amount of a compound, such as bacteria, present in the bodily fluid; a tray carrying a reagent that darkens relative to the amount of the compound present in a bodily fluid that contacts the strip; and, computer readable instructions included in the control module for receiving the numeric value and transmitting the numeric value to a local server.

Method for preparing chook Marek's disease virus infection detection antigen

The invention discloses a preparation method of AGP detection antigen used for diagnosing Marek's virus infection, relating to the poultry disease detection reagent field. The method comprises the steps as follows: firstly, the separating effect experimental evaluation is carried out on the target virus antigen, so that a permeation-typed filter membrane element and a retention-typed filter membrane element are screened out from ultrafiltration membrane elements with different molecular weight cutoff; secondly, the permeation-typed filter membrane element and the retention-typed filter membrane element which are screened out are respectively used to purify and concentrate the liquid containing the target virus antigen; finally, the purified and concentrated solution is detected and quantified, so that the Marek's virus infection AGP detection antigen is prepared; and no reagent is added in the process of ultrafiltration treatment, therefore, not only neither secondary pollution nor contamination is produced in the production process, but also the emission liquid is actually further purified, so as to reduce the pollution to the environment and improve resource utilization, thereby really achieving the purpose of transforming trash into treasure, and the preparation method also has the advantages of no phase state change, mild conditions, simple operation, low cost and high recovery rate, etc.
